Burwash is a quintessential East Sussex village located in the High Weald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ty, approximately 12 miles south of Tunbridge Wells. The village is characterised by its rolling countryside, period stone cottages, Georgian properties, and Victorian terraced homes, many of which retain original features and charm. Situated between Heathfield and Etchingham, Burwash appeals to homeowners seeking rural character while maintaining reasonable proximity to larger towns and transport links.
Common kitchen refurbishment projects in Burwash include updating dated 1970s-1990s fitted kitchens, improving storage and workflow in period cottages with awkward layouts, and installing modern appliances while maintaining original alcoves and chimney breasts. Many TN19 homeowners also require specialist work adapting kitchens to uneven floors typical of older properties, or creating open-plan spaces while respecting conservation area regulations.
